1K Phew is an Atlanta-based hip-hop artist recognized for his authentic approach to music, which integrates his faith with the trap music culture of his upbringing. His stage name, ‘1K Phew,’ signifies his commitment to being ‘1,000’ percent real in his music and personal life. His early career included mixtapes such as ‘Sunday Night’ in 2015 and ‘Life’ in 2016, which showcased his developing sound and lyrical style. These releases laid the groundwork for his entry into the industry, establishing him as an artist with a distinct voice and message.
A significant turning point in 1K Phew’s career was his signing with Reach Records in 2017, a move that expanded his reach and influence within the music industry. This partnership led to notable collaborations and projects, including his involvement in the 2019 season anthem for the Atlanta Falcons, his hometown team. He was instrumental in facilitating the collaboration between Grammy-winning producer Zaytoven and Reach Records co-founder Lecrae, which resulted in the critically acclaimed album “Let the Trap Say Amen.” His album, “What’s Understood 2” (WU2), further solidified his unique position, featuring collaborations with artists like Skooly, Lecrae, WHATUPRG, Jamie Grace, and Foggie Raw. The album was described as a project that helped him mature as an artist and as an individual.
His career also includes recognized achievements such as winning the Rap/Hip Hop Album of the Year at the 53rd Annual GMA Dove Awards with Lecrae for their collaborative project “No Church in a While” (2021). The album “Pray For Atlanta,” a joint venture with Zaytoven, was released on January 19, 2024, and included appearances from artists like Young Dro, Hunxho, and Jekalyn Carr. 1K Phew continues to embody transparency in his music, addressing themes of personal growth and faith, and encouraging listeners to embrace their authenticity. His music aims to bridge traditional divides between secular and gospel audiences, conveying a message of self-acceptance and spiritual reflection.
